Challenge Day 1- Write a letter

For the first day of our challenge together, I wanted to start off with something very simple, but meaningful. Today’s challenge is to write a card to someone who is alone. Think of someone who might enjoy a fun note and get writing! You can make a card or find a blank one hanging around the house.

As for who to send it to: I am writing to an older lady I met at our local Starbucks before it was closed. She lives alone and I’m worried that she might be lonely. In my note, I included my phone number so that she can contact me if she wants. You could also send a note to your best friend, your grandparents, cousins, a teacher, or a neighbor.

If you don’t have a stamp, you can ask your parents. In the United States, the USPS is open for business and ships stamps online. Or, you can write a card for someone who lives nearby and leave it on their porch when you’re out for a walk.
